The Motorsport Heartbeat of the Porsche 911

Every car enthusiast knows the Porsche 911 isn’t just a vehicle. It’s a living motorsport legend that blurs the line between track weapon and everyday sports car. For decades, the 911 has inspired drivers and dominated circuits worldwide, thanks to its unmistakable performance pedigree and instantly recognizable silhouette.

Meanwhile, few cars anywhere carry such a racing bloodline. Since its 1963 debut, the 911’s rear-engined layout and relentless development have set it apart. You feel the DNA of Le Mans, Sebring, and countless championship wins every time you turn the key.

Model Evolution: Rare Editions and Revolutionary Upgrades

Over the years, the Porsche 911 has evolved from a humble 130-horsepower daily driver into a wildly varied lineup spanning everything from the everyday Carrera to untamed GT3 RS circuit legends. In contrast, the 911’s unique model code system—like 930, 964, and the legendary 993—captures each era’s engineering milestones.

For example, rare air-cooled variants such as the 993 Turbo or GT2 fetch staggering prices among collectors. Meanwhile, modern editions like the 992 Turbo S blend relentless acceleration with a luxury ride, showcasing Porsche’s ongoing innovation.

Many car lovers chase rare, limited-run editions. Some examples include:

  • Porsche 911 R (2016) – Manual gearbox, pure delight
  • Porsche 911 GT2 RS (2018) – Track-focused beast
  • Porsche 911 Sport Classic – Modern homage to the 1970s
  • Porsche 911 Turbo S Exclusive Series – Bespoke power and style

Born For The Track: Racing Legacy and Unmatched Pedigree

Motorsport success sits at the core of the 911 story. Each model carries lessons from 24 Hours of Le Mans and the Nürburgring, ensuring on-road thrills translate directly from some of racing’s toughest events. Therefore, Porsche engineers keep honing every generation, blending lightning-fast lap times with everyday usability.

For example, the 911 GT3 lineage has become the go-to for drivers who demand an authentic motorsport experience. In addition, the Carrera Cup series and IMSA championships have featured countless 911s, proving their durability and competitive edge over rivals.

  1. Porsche 911 GT3 – Developed from race-winning technology
  2. Porsche 911 RSR – Built for endurance racing
  3. Porsche 911 Cup Car – Mainstay of one-make racing series
  4. Porsche 911 Turbo S – Record-setting performance for the road

Interior Craftsmanship: Customization and Advanced Tech

Climbing into a Porsche 911, you instantly recognize the blend of tradition and cutting-edge tech. For example, the analog tachometer remains a centerpiece in most models, even as touchscreens, digital dials, and adaptive controls come as standard.

Meanwhile, Porsche’s exclusive Manufaktur program lets owners order everything from custom paint to unique trims, bespoke stitching, and motorsport-inspired materials. As a result, every 911 can tell its own story.

For those craving both luxury and performance, the cockpit delivers with supportive sport seats, a compact steering wheel, and ergonomic controls positioned for spirited driving. In addition, Bose and Burmester audio systems create a concert-like atmosphere for drivers who never compromise on sound.

Collector Appeal and Resale Value: The 911’s Enduring Magic

Few sports cars can promise such phenomenal long-term value and appeal. For example, air-cooled models like the 993 Turbo and special editions such as the GT2 RS often appreciate over time. Meanwhile, even base Carrera models retain value better than many high-end rivals, proving the 911’s reputation holds strong in the used car market.

Therefore, smart buyers and collectors eye the 911 not just for thrill-packed drives, but also as a potential investment. Furthermore, Porsche’s limited production runs, bespoke upgrades, and racing achievements give each edition a powerful mystique few brands can match.
